For over 20 years, 365 days a year, Native ARC has been caring for sick,
injured and orphaned native wildlife.
Animals are under a constant threat from humans. Habitat loss, injury
and death are all problems caused by the encroachment of human
development. Native ARC, with the help of local veterinarians,
provides the expertise and facilities to save these animals.
